“All four men accused in the gang rape and murder of a young veterinarian in Telangana have been killed in an encounter. The accused, identified as Mohammed Arif, Naveen,Shiva and Chennakeshavulu were killed in police firing at Chatanpally, Shadnagar today in the wee hours, between 3 and 6am.I have reached the spot and further details will be revealed,” said Cyberabad Police Commissioner V C Sajjanar.
Family of Hyderabad Vet Thanks Police | Speaking to media, the sister of the Hyderabad vet who was raped and murdered on November 28 says, “I am happy the four accused have been killed in an encounter. This incident will set an example. I thank the police and media for their support.” The woman’s father, too, thanks Telangana police. “Her soul will rest in peace now,” he says.
The bodies of the four accused have been taken to Shadnagar government hospital. During the encounter at Chatanpally near Shadnagar, three police personnel were also injured, Firstpost reported.

Leading the chorus of angry parliamentarians, Samajwadi Party MP Jaya Bachchan Monday said rapists should be “brought out in public and lynched.” “I don’t know how many times I’ve stood and spoken after this kind of crime. I think it is time… whether Nirbhaya or Kathua or what happened in Telangana… I think the people now want the government to give a proper and definite answer,” she had said.
Lynching the rapists, death penalty and castration of the accused were some of the suggestions that Parliamentarians proposed on Monday as they expressed outrage over the 26-year-old veterinarian’s rape in Hyderabad. Union Minister Rajnath Singh, meanwhile, said that the Centre is “ready for discussions to curb such crimes”.
The Accused Were Lodged in Cherlapally Central Prison | Officers said that police were able to track the accused based on inputs from people, clues from the crime scene and CCTV footage. The four accused, arrested on November 29, were in judicial custody and were lodged in high security cells in Cherlapally Central Prison amid high security and additional police deployment. They were charged under IPC sections 302 (murder), 375 (rape) and 362 (abduction).
The young woman’s rape and murder had sent shock waves across the nation after her body, badly burnt, was found last week near Hyderabad. On November 28, the men, all truck-drivers and cleaners, saw the woman park her scooter near a toll-booth and leave. They allegedly punctured her tyre and waited. When she returned, they pretended to help, gang-raped her, strangled her and burnt her body to destroy evidence, according to the police.
Police Opened Fire After Accused Tried Escaping | The police had taken the four accused to the crime spot for a recce to recreate the crime scene when the four tried to escape, following which the cops fired at them. The encounter took place at Chatanpally near Shadnagar, where the 26-year-old victim’s charred body was found.
Hyderabad Rape-Murder Accused Killed in Encounter | All four men accused in the gang rape and murder of a young veterinarian in Telangana have been killed in an encounter, the Cyberabad police said on Friday. The 26-year-old veterinarian, went missing from Shamshabad toll plaza, near Hyderabad, on Wednesday night. The four accused raped and then burnt her to death, the police have said. Her burnt body was recovered the following day.
